
Data Engineer - Relocation to Abu Dhabi
On site
London, United Kingdom
Full Time
21-03-2025
Job Specifications
Job Title: Data Engineer
Location: Relocation to Abu Dhabi (Relocation support provided)
Salary: 20k/30k AED Per Month - Tax-Free + Benefits
Salary: 5,500k/6,500k USD per month Tax Free
Full-time, Permanent position
Onsite with occasional travel
About Our Client:
Our client is a leading tech business specializing in AI and Big data, focusing on leveraging and implementing AI tools and cutting-edge technologies.
As a Data Engineer, you’ll be building the foundational components of their platform such as Data catalog, ingestion, batch, and streaming transformations, AI/ML-enabled enrichment, storage layer, and resilient pipelines.
Key Responsibilities:
At least 7+ years of programming experience, proficient in SQL and Python or Java
You will contribute to the development of in-house DataOps and MLOps components
Design and implement batch and streaming data processing systems and ML pipelines
Enhance the platform with best practices in Data Governance, Data Quality, and Policy Management
Collaborate with Solution and Product teams on POC projects, providing data engineering support.
Deploy the platform at client sites, ensuring optimal performance with data analysts and engineers.
Experience building resilient data pipelines using tools like Spark, Flink, Kafka, Airflow, etc.
Knowledge of optimizing distributed data processing systems and infrastructure.
Experience in dimensional modeling.
Practical experience with data platforms (data lakes, warehouses, ETL, real-time processing).
Qualifications:
Bachelor's in Computer Science or related field.

- Data Center Engineer - Electrical Birmingham Qualified Electrician needed for a large data centre specialist. Working alongside the network / ICT Data Centre Engineer, you will provide the electrical expertise to the data centre. You will be responsible for Equipment installation and troubleshooting Performing routine inspections and maintenance of critical infrastructure including power, cooling and network systems Operate, monitor, and maintain all HV and LV systems, ensuring compliance with safety and operational protocols. Perform scheduled and reactive maintenance on electrical systems, including switchgear, UPS, generators, and BMS. Conduct HV switching operations as per Safe Systems of Work. Respond promptly to technical issues, diagnosing faults, and implementing repairs. Maintain up-to-date records and logs of maintenance activities, ensuring compliance with industry standards. Oversee and execute hands on preventative maintenance on site infrastructure, either directly or through vendor management, including managing the permit to work system. (UPS, generators, BMS, chillers, and life safety systems. HV switching experience preferred) About you Qualified Engineer – 17th or 18th Edition You will come from a Critical background or other Engineering maintenance environments, such as Pharmaceutical, Power stations, Banking, Industrial or Maritime engineering. You will have hands-on experience of covering the planned and reactive maintenance to Single & three-phase power, UPS, Power Generators, lighting, HVAC plant, air conditioning, etc Previous experience in data centre or critical environment settings is beneficial.
